Как работают дисковые системы
Как работают дисковые системы
Файловая структура образует себя систему, что отвечает под сохранение, организацию а также доступ до информации на электронном устройстве. Она задает, как документы сохраняются на диске, как формируются папки, каким образом проводится Покердом считывание, сохранение, копирование а также удаление сведений. Без файловой среды устройство сохранения оставалось бы множеством ячеек хранилища без наличия понятной схемы.
Внутри компьютерной системе файловая система выполняет роль упорядочивателя сведений. Вспомогательные материалы, например как покердом скачать, позволяют структурировать понимание процесса, как именно данные записывается, структурируется а также считывается. Ключевое внимание отводится структуре сохранения, скорости доступа, устойчивости и управлению прав.
Функции файловой системы
Основная цель файловой среды — создать удобную работу со данными. Пользователь или приложение видит документы, папки, названия и расширения, а внутренняя среда управляет реальным Pokerdom размещением информации в пределах носителе. Это дает возможность обращаться с материалами, картинками, программами а также системными файлами без прямого обращения к блокам накопителя.
Файловая система дополнительно предназначена под организацию. Она фиксирует информацию касательно объекта, куда расположен каждый документ, каков для него вес, когда он стал сформирован и какие разрешения доступа к файлу применяются. За счет данному механизму рабочая система получает возможность оперативно искать нужные сведения и контролировать процедуры со данными.
Также отдельная ключевая задача — страховка от утраты сведений. Современные дисковые системы применяют записи, запасные структуры Покердом официальный сайт и контроль целостности. Такие инструменты позволяют возобновить данные по окончании ошибки энергоснабжения, проблемы сохранения а также некорректного прекращения функционирования.
Файлы а также каталоги
Документ является главной частью сохранения информации. Он способен включать символы, изображение, видеофайл, программу, сжатый файл или системную данные. Каждый файл получает имя, размер, тип и местоположение внутри организации Покердом сбережения.
Директории служат для сортировки документов. Каталоги создают систему, внутри которой сведения распределяются внутри каталогам а также дочерним подпапкам. Данный метод упрощает ориентацию и дает возможность классифицировать сведения по категориям, работам, форматам либо срокам.
Внутри системном слое директория тоже выступает отдельной единицей сведений. Объект содержит информацию о файлах и внутренних папках. Если среда загружает папку, она считывает такие строки а также выводит список доступных Pokerdom файлов.
Служебные данные файлов
Метаданные — представляют собой техническая информация о объекте. Сведения характеризуют никак не содержимое, а параметры файла. К числу служебным данным принадлежат объем, момент создания, время обновления, владелец, права доступа, вид файла а также адрес участков данных.
Рабочая среда применяет метаданные ради управления файлами. К примеру, в процессе упорядочивании по времени платформа подключается не к наполнению Покердом официальный сайт объекта, а к его техническим характеристикам. При валидации допуска кроме того проверяются дополнительные сведения.
Дополнительные сведения помогают повысить взаимодействие со большим числом документов. Без наличия них системе потребовалось бы бы каждый раз целиком анализировать наполнение файлов, это сильно снизило бы выполнение операций.
Расположение сведений на носителе
Дисковая система разделяет диск на участки либо группы. Если создается документ, данное Покердом контент сохраняется на единый либо несколько указанных участков. В случае если файл небольшой, файл может заполнять единый участок. Если объект большой, информация делятся по разным секторам.
Кластеры не постоянно выстроены рядом. В процессе постоянном создании, изменении и удалении объектов доступное место занимается неравномерно. В результате отдельный файл способен быть разбит на участки, размещенные внутри различных областях накопителя Pokerdom.
Данное процесс именуется разбиением. В пределах жестких дисках процедура способна замедлять скорость считывания, поскольку что механическим элементам приходится переходить к различным областям накопителя. В случае новых SSD дисках воздействие разбиения ниже, но грамотное размещение данных все же является важным.
Структуры расположения а также индексы
Чтобы обнаруживать информацию, файловая среда задействует служебные Покердом официальный сайт таблицы и каталоги. В этих структур хранится сведения про том, какого типа участки принадлежат отдельному файлу. В момент когда сервис загружает объект, среда сначала обращается к указанным техническим таблицам.
В рамках базовых системных системах задействуется схема расположения объектов. Схема отображает цепочку участков и дает возможность восстановить документ изнутри разных фрагментов. Внутри значительно продвинутых структурах задействуются указатели, структуры и другие схемы с целью оптимизации нахождения.
Каталогизация наиболее значима в процессе обращении с большим количеством данных. Если скорее система обнаруживает Покердом дополнительные сведения и блоки объекта, тем самым оперативнее выполняются действия просмотра, фиксации а также поиска.
Разрешения доступа
Файловая структура регулирует, какая учетная запись может открывать, корректировать либо исключать документы. Для этого применяются права доступа. Они способны назначаться для нужд автора файла, группы участников или всех пользователей системы.
Основные разрешения чаще всего содержат чтение, сохранение а также исполнение. Просмотр помогает просматривать содержимое, изменение — изменять информацию, исполнение — выполнять объект как скрипт Pokerdom либо скрипт. Для директорий эти права получают специальные нюансы, соотнесенные со просмотром и обновлением содержимого папки.
Контроль доступа помогает обезопасить информацию против непреднамеренного исключения и несанкционированного вмешательства. В коллективных средах такой контроль в особенности важно, так как различные аккаунты могут взаимодействовать с единым а также одним же накопителем.
Журналирование дисковой среды
Логирование используется для улучшения стабильности. Перед осуществлением важных операций файловая система записывает данные про планируемых операциях на отдельный реестр. Когда случается нарушение, реестр позволяет Покердом официальный сайт установить, какие операции были выполнены, а какие остались незавершенными.
Данный инструмент уменьшает риск разрушения организации сохранения. К примеру, в случае если файл перемещался в течение период отключения питания, журнал позволяет получить целостное состояние среды.
Ведение журнала не обязательно оберегает основное наполнение файла против исчезновения, но позволяет поддержать неповрежденность служебных структур. Данный фактор значимо для стабильной функционирования рабочей платформы а также снижения серьезных сбоев хранения.
Разметка а также инициализация системной среды
Перед использованием накопителя чаще всего осуществляется подготовка. Внутри процессе этого процесса строится организация Покердом файловой системы: списки, внутренние зоны, корневой папка а также характеристики расположения сведений.
Разметка может выполняться ускоренным либо полным. Ускоренное разметка создает новую структуру без наличия полного очистки имеющихся сведений. Глубокое форматирование также проверяет состояние носителя и способно отнимать дольше периода.
Выбор системной среды формируется исходя из накопителя а также задач. Отдельные форматы эффективнее подходят для основных разделов, другие — для нужд съемных дисков, карт сохранения а также поддержки между различными операционными средами.
Виды системных структур
Используется множество распространенных системных сред. NTFS обычно задействуется внутри Windows а также обеспечивает права допуска, журналирование и обращение с крупными объектами. FAT32 отличается значительной поддержкой, однако имеет пределы по весу Pokerdom объекта.
exFAT часто применяется в отношении флеш-накопителей и дополнительных накопителей, так что поддерживает объемные объекты а также сочетается с разными системами. Внутри системах Linux используются ext4 и другие системные структуры, ориентированные на стабильность и гибкую работу с разрешениями.
Отдельная дисковая структура содержит свои достоинства и лимиты. Поэтому подбор формируется от размера сведений, нужд по части защите, скорости обработки а также поддержке с носителями.
Временное хранение в процессе взаимодействии с файлами
Буферизация дает возможность оптимизировать действия считывания а также записи. Платформа на время хранит постоянно используемые данные на оперативной памяти устройства, с целью никак не переходить до диску всякий момент. Такой подход особенно полезно в процессе повторном открытии тех и тех самых документов.
В процессе записи сведения способны изначально записываться на буфер, и потом записываться внутри накопитель. Данный механизм Покердом официальный сайт увеличивает быстроту функционирования, при этом нуждается в корректного завершения операций. В случае если питание прервется раньше записи внутри носитель, доля сведений имеет вероятность оказаться утрачена.
Поэтому системные среды применяют средства обновления. Системы регулярно сбрасывают данные с кэша в пределах накопитель и фиксируют изменения. Такой процесс помогает сочетать производительность а также сохранность.
Ошибки а также нарушения дисковой структуры
Системная система имеет возможность повреждаться вследствие ошибок энергоснабжения, ошибок устройства, неправильного отключения накопителя или программных проблем. Сбой может затронуть конкретные документы, директории или технические структуры.
С целью диагностики задействуются отдельные инструменты. Утилиты сканируют таблицы, указатели, связи внутри участками а также дополнительные сведения. Если выявлены ошибки, система старается получить согласованное положение.
Не все любые нарушения получается исправить полностью. Поэтому важную роль получает запасное копирование. Даже стабильная дисковая среда никак не исключает систематическое сохранение ценных информации внутри резервном месте.
Эффективность системной структуры
Производительность обработки файловой среды зависит от вида накопителя, объема кластеров, объема документов, степени разбиения а также варианта систематизации. Значительное количество малых объектов может обрабатываться медленнее, чем множество крупных объектов аналогичного самого суммарного объема.
Скорость также формируется от варианта работы. Для выполнения некоторых целей важна производительность линейного обращения, в других прочих — оперативный обращение к отдельным фрагментам сведений. Поэтому различные дисковые среды могут показывать разные показатели внутри разных условиях.
Оптимизация предполагает грамотный подбор типа, периодическую диагностику положения носителя, отслеживание свободного пространства и грамотную организацию папок. Такие процедуры дают возможность сохранять устойчивую быстроту работы.
